Top Corporate Security Executive develops the overall security strategy, policies, and standards to ensure the physical safety of all visitors, employees, or customers to the organization's facilities and the security of property and assets. Establishes auditing and inspection protocols to assess, identify, and mitigate any security vulnerabilities or gaps. Being a Top Corporate Security Executive plans and prepares for crisis response, disaster recovery, evacuation, workplace violence, and other emergency events. Assesses systems, alarms, and other physical security measures for effectiveness. Additionally, Top Corporate Security Executive designs and delivers company education programs on security policies and topics to ensure staff is adequately informed and equipped to manage potential security issues. Participates in local, state, provincial, or federal working or advisory groups to keep abreast with all security-related information, directives, and events. Leads and directs major investigations and critical event responses in coordination with law enforcement and other officials or agencies. Possess broad and deep knowledge of law enforcement methods, tactics, and procedures. Requires a bachelor's degree in law enforcement, criminal justice, security, or related discipline. Typically reports to top management. The Top Corporate Security Executive man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. To be a Top Corporate Security Executive typ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    DESCRIPTION:

    PURPOSE OF JOB:

    This non-supervisory position is responsible for developing and maintaining vehicle and equipment leasing and finance business. Working closely in conjunction with the company's administrative, operations and accounting staff, the Corporate Account Executive (CAE) is responsible for generating sales that meet company criteria which will align with strategic growth initiatives.

    JOB DUTIES:

    Sales Originations

    • Achieve sales goals as defined in the Annual Business Plan by working existing client base for additional business as well as establishing new customer accounts through a variety of activities, such as outside lunches, trade shows, and client visits, which are all expected in the development of new business and the growth of the existing customer base.
    • Work with our Director of Marketing and the Vice President, Business Development to actively produce digital campaigns to assist in lead generation.
    • Follow marketing plan initiatives.
    • Prepare presentations and relationship documentation.
    • Quote deals, locate equipment and vehicles, and follow workflows for underwriting and required documentation.
    • Effectively and timely utilize various software systems and applications associated with our business including Aspire and Salesforce.

    Customer Relationship Management

    • Actively contact existing active and dormant customers, servicing their needs for new business, quoting, pricing, and locating equipment as well as continual development of those relationships.
    • Contact customers as defined in and following the United Leasing & Finance (ULF) Sales Customer Relationship Management Policy & Procedure.
    • Actively manage the maturing lease/loan contacts, arranging disposition details and operational notifications to both accounting and billing departments respective to all assigned mature accounts. Verify that the list is accurate. Ensure these customers are thanked for their business and seek opportunities for additional business.
    • Assist in the collection of existing past-due customer accounts, as required.
    • Using Salesforce, follow-up on all prospects, current, and dormant customers as defined in Business Plan.
    • Closely monitor and report on competitor activities, marketplace concerns, and other activities which could impact the company in your market area.
    • Coordinate frequent customer visits, as approved by management.
    • Conduct Quarterly Review meetings with key customers.

    Credit Analysis

    • Obtain required credit and financial information from credit applicants and prepare a credit overview of each new sales opportunity.
    • Maintain basic knowledge of the interpretation of financial statements, balance sheets, profit/loss and income statements, etc. as required in the completion of management approval documentation.

Evansville is a city and the county seat of Vanderburgh County, Indiana, United States. The population was 117,429 at the 2010 census, making it the state's third-most populous city after Indianapolis and Fort Wayne, the largest city in Southern Indiana, and the 232nd-most populous city in the United States. It is the commercial, medical, and cultural hub of Southwestern Indiana and the Illinois-Indiana-Kentucky tri-state area, home to over 911,000 people.
